Overview

England in the second half of the 20th century. After a long military service abroad, General Fitzbatress returns home. He is greeted by his adult hippie son and pregnant daughter. The general sincerely tries to understand his wife's and children's life principles. The play presents a unique perspective on the issue of fathers and children, showcasing the exceptional acting skills of the cast. The production is based on a play by Peter Ustinov.
